Martha’s Top Picks from IRIS

BA&SH Vianey embroidered dress. “Although this might seem at first like a perfect holiday piece, there’s no reason why you couldn’t wear it to a Summer party. I love the embroidered detail. By day I’d wear it with flat sandals, lots of bangles and earrings, and swap to a heeled sandal for evening”.


KIREI Striped top and Marrakech MIh jeans.” I love an unconventional stripe, and I love the fact this top is not an obvious blue – it’s quite vintage-y. It has lovely ladder stitch detail and is a great blouson shape. It looks amazing with the MiH Marrakech jeans, which are the perfect vintage, faded blue”.

MASSCOB Calma Lace Blouse.“I’m a sucker for macrame and lace – this is a dream blouse. It would look super-cool with cropped jeans or shorts.”

BA&SH Manon Top“This is a really pretty peasant top which is a big trend this season. It can be worn anywhere with anything. I love the combination of blue and white for Summer and I love the added little polkadot detail”.

IRIS Quilted JacketI’m a big fan of a lightweight Summer jacket, especially living in England. You can’t leave the house without one! I love the quilted aspect and the fact that it’s reversible if you don”t feel like wearing the print, you can go for the plain side.”

LOUISE MISHA Tomete & Abelia Clutch BagI’m never without a little pouch bag and this one is sure to turn any plain outfit into something more interesting due to the sequin and tassel detail.”

ISABEL MARANT ETOILE Camila Rope SandalsYou can’t go wrong with a pair of simple understated sandals in the Summer, and these have the added benefit of being by Isabel Marant.”

JEROME DREYFUSS Eliot Chain BagA key item in every wardrobe should be a tan bag. It’s the best colour to team with just about anything as it’s so neutral. I love the fact that it’s a crossbody and the gorgeous gold detail.”

MASSCOB Gabi Black Paisley Skirt.This reminds me of a beautiful vintage Indian skirt I have. In Summer I’d wear it with a simple vest, and in Winter it would look great with a skinny polo neck and pixi boots.”
